From mboxrd@z Thu Jan 1 00:00:00 1970 From: Nicolas Goaziou Subject: Re: Bug: Org Table Performance Issue/Regression Date: Mon, 03 Sep 2018 09:59:57 +0200 Message-ID: <87ftyrui2q.fsf@nicolasgoaziou.fr> References: <87lgb1swbm.fsf@nicolasgoaziou.fr> <7C8B6AAC-5AFC-4882-A423-6B70C620E677@me.com> Mime-Version: 1.0 Content-Type: text/plain Return-path: Received: from eggs.gnu.org ([2001:4830:134:3::10]:45084)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1fwjmG-0008Ay-7X for emacs-orgmode@gnu.org; Mon, 03 Sep 2018 04:00:08 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1fwjmD-000448-0p for emacs-orgmode@gnu.org; Mon, 03 Sep 2018 04:00:04 -0400 Received: from relay10.mail.gandi.net ([217.70.178.230]:41423) by eggs.gnu.org with esmtps (TLS1.0:DHE_RSA_AES_256_CBC_SHA1:32) (Exim 4.71) (envelope-from ) id 1fwjmC-00042g-QM for emacs-orgmode@gnu.org; Mon, 03 Sep 2018 04:00:00 -0400 In-Reply-To: <7C8B6AAC-5AFC-4882-A423-6B70C620E677@me.com> (Tim Baumgard's message of "Sun, 15 Jul 2018 21:47:31 -0500") List-Id: "General discussions about Org-mode."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: emacs-orgmode-bounces+geo-emacs-orgmode=m.gmane.org@gnu.org Sender: "Emacs-orgmode" To: Tim Baumgard Cc: emacs-orgmode@gnu.org Hello, Tim Baumgard writes: >> On Jun 26, 2018, at 4:58 AM, Nicolas Goaziou wrote: >> >> Could you send the result of your profiling (using both Elp and >> profiler would be nice) on an uncompiled Org? > > I've attached ten profiler results: Two are from 25.3 with the garbage collector > running normally, two are from 25.3 with the garbage collector "disabled" as > described in my previous email, two are from 26.1 with the garbage collector > running normally, two are from 26.1 with the garbage collector "disabled," and > two are the Elp profiles--I used elp-instrument-package--for both versions. > > In case it helps, my process to obtain these has been: > > 1. I use the test.org file from my previous email with the test row duplicated > so that it occurs 3500 times. I can't remember how many rows I used in my > previous tests. > 2. I invoke Emacs by calling "Emacs.app/Contents/MacOS/Emacs -Q" > 3. I use "M-x load-file" to load the test init.el file I included in my previous > email, with the last two lines commented out or not depending on what I'm > testing. > 4. I then open the test.org file and go to column A in the last row. > 5. I then start one of the profilers, hit enter, hit shift+enter > (org-table-copy-down), and then get the report from the profiler. > > Let me know if I can provide anything else. I think master branch behaves better now. Could you confirm it? Regards, -- Nicolas Goaziou 0x80A93738